What can I see and do near State Gallery?
Mercedes-Benz Museum, Porsche Museum and Old Castle feature captivating exhibits. Neues Schloss, Charles Square (Karlsplatz) and Gottlieb Daimler Memorial are some of the local landmarks to explore. You can check out the local talent at Stuttgart National Theater, Opera and Palladium Theater.
How can I get to State Gallery?
With so many transport options, seeing all of the area near State Gallery is a breeze. Walk to nearby metro stations like Schlossplatz U-Bahn, Friedrichsbau U-Bahn and Stuttgart Central Station S-Bahn (tief). If you're hopping a train into town, Stuttgart Central Station, Büchsenstraße Bus Stop and Stuttgart (ZWS-Stuttgart Central Station) are the closest train stations to Stuttgart-Mitte.
